在Unix环境下进行Python项目开发时,优化系统配置可以显著提升开发效率。合理设置环境变量、使用高效的终端工具和编辑器,能够减少不必要的等待时间。
安装并配置合适的Python版本管理工具,如pyenv或conda,可以帮助快速切换不同版本的Python环境,避免因版本冲突导致的构建问题。
使用高效的包管理工具,如pip或poetry,配合虚拟环境,可以有效隔离项目依赖,确保每个项目的依赖独立且稳定,提高开发和测试的可靠性。
利用Unix的命令行工具链,如grep、sed、awk等,可以快速处理日志文件、调试信息和数据,提升代码调试和问题排查的速度。

AI绘图结果,仅供参考
自动化构建和测试流程也是提速的关键。通过CI/CD工具如GitHub Actions或GitLab CI,可以在代码提交后自动运行测试和部署任务,减少手动操作。
合理利用Unix的进程管理和资源监控工具,如top、htop、ps等,有助于及时发现性能瓶颈,优化程序运行效率。
•保持系统更新和清理无用的缓存文件,有助于维持系统的流畅运行,为Python开发提供更稳定的底层环境。